On 6/4/16 3:10 AM, Venkata Balaji N wrote:
On Sat, Jun 4, 2016 at 5:35 PM, sangeetha <tune2sangee@xxxxxxxxx <mailto:tune2sangee@xxxxxxxxx>> wrote: SELECT pg_database_size('DB1') takes 60ms for 7948 kB size DB. Is there any way to reduce the time taken or any other ways to find data base size? What is the version of PostgreSQL you are using ? You can execute the command "\l+" which will list all the databases and their sizes. Or you can execute "\l+ <database-name>".
Depending on your needs, you could also take the sum of pg_class.relpages and multiply that by BLKSZ.
-- Jim Nasby, Data Architect, Blue Treble Consulting, Austin TX Experts in Analytics, Data Architecture and PostgreSQL Data in Trouble? Get it in Treble! http://BlueTreble.com 855-TREBLE2 (855-873-2532) mobile: 512-569-9461 -- Sent via pgsql-performance mailing list (pgsql-performance@xxxxxxxxxxxxxx) To make changes to your subscription: http://www.postgresql.org/mailpref/pgsql-performance